How does a dental filling work?

A dental filling is a procedure that restores the function and aesthetics of a tooth damaged by decay or trauma. After removing the compromised tissue, the tooth is sealed with strong, biocompatible materials. How is a cavity treated?

Treating a cavity involves intervening as soon as possible to prevent more serious damage. The process includes removing the affected part of the tooth and reconstructing it with a filling. How long does a dental filling last?

The longevity of a filling depends on the material used, the location of the treated tooth, and the patient’s habits. On average, a well-executed filling can last many years, especially with good oral hygiene and regular check-ups. How to know if you have a cavity?

Signs such as sensitivity to hot or cold, pain while chewing, or dark spots on teeth may indicate a cavity. However, many early cavities are asymptomatic and hard to detect without a dental visit. Risks of untreated cavities

An untreated cavity can lead to serious consequences, including infections, abscesses, or even tooth loss. Ignoring the issue not only risks oral health but also affects overall well-being.
